Kelp Records is a record label based in Ottawa, Canada. It was formed in March 1994 by Jon Bartlett in Fredericton, New Brunswick. Its current roster features Andrew Vincent and the Pirates, The Acorn, Camp Radio, Detective Kalita, Flecton, Greenfield Main, Jim Bryson, Rhume and Proffessor Undressor, Chris Page, The Flaps, Recoilers and Andy Swan.
